MARTIN, Antony
Personal Details
Service Number: | 812 |
---|---|
Enlisted: | 20 August 1914, Enlisted at Melbourne, Victoria |
Last Rank: | Private |
Last Unit: | 5th Infantry Battalion |
Born: | Rutherglen, Victoria, Australia, 1893 |
Home Town: | Rutherglen, Indigo, Victoria |
Schooling: | Not yet discovered |
Occupation: | Grocer |
Died: | Killed in Action, Gallipoli, 8 May 1915 |
Cemetery: |
No known grave - "Known Unto God" |
Memorials: | Australian War Memorial Roll of Honour, Helles Memorial, Gallipoli, Rutherglen War Memorial |

Son of Matthew and E.A. Martin of Ready Street, Rutherglen, Victoria
Medals: 1914-15 Star, British War Medal, Victory Medal
Also served in the State School Cadets
